EOS has secured a US$124m (~A$175m) order for its Slinger Counter-Drone Remote Weapon System (“RWS”), to be supplied to Generation 5 Holding L.L.C (“Gen5”). Gen5 is a 100% United Arab Emirates (“UAE”) owned provider of defence equipment, technology and services headquartered in Abu Dhabi in the UAE.
